
This two-year diploma program “prepares students to be leaders in the rapidly evolving food sector,” according to the program website.
Students will complete courses such as: chemistry for food technicians; food and agricultural regulations and policies; greenhouse structure, controls and energy management; integrated pest management; food microbiology; farm planning an design; and food safety.
Applicants must hold an Ontario Secondary School Diploma (OSSD) or mature student status, and have completed grade 12 English (C or U) and grade 11 mathematics (C, M or U).
